Variations to Try

One of the best aspects of the Cheddar Ranch Cheeseball is its adaptability. While the classic version is delicious, feel free to mix in your own favorite ingredients. For instance, add diced jalapeños for a spicy kick, or incorporate crumbled bacon for a smoky flavor. Chopped herbs like parsley or dill can introduce fresh notes that elevate the taste even more.

If you’re looking for a healthier twist, consider exchanging the cream cheese with a lower-fat or dairy-free alternative. This slight modification can make it easier for guests with dietary restrictions to indulge without sacrificing flavor. Experimenting with different ingredients allows you to tailor this cheeseball to suit your taste and dietary needs perfectly.

Ingredients

Gather your ingredients:

Ingredients

  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1 packet ranch dressing mix
  • 1/2 cup chopped green onions
  • 1/2 cup chopped pecans (optional)
  • Fresh veggies, crackers, or toasted bread for serving

Mix all ingredients until combined.

Instructions

Follow these steps to prepare:

Mix the Cheese

In a mixing bowl, combine the softened cream cheese, shredded cheddar cheese, and ranch dressing mix.

Add Onion and Nuts

Fold in the chopped green onions and, if desired, the chopped pecans.

Shape the Cheeseball

Form the mixture into a ball and wrap it in plastic wrap. Refrigerate for at least 1 hour to set.

Serve chilled with your choice of accompaniments.

Storage Tips

If you have any leftovers (which is always a possibility!), storing the Cheddar Ranch Cheeseball correctly is key to maintaining its freshness. W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and store it in the refrigerator. When properly sealed, it can last for up to a week, although its flavor may deepen over time, making each bite even better.

For longer storage, consider freezing the cheeseball. Simply wrap it in plastic wrap and then in aluminum foil before placing it in the freezer. Thaw in the refrigerator before serving, and your cheeseball will be as delicious as when it was freshly made!
